I noticed that the base rules give no encouragement to using Hand-and-a-Half style weapons, (bastard sword, dwarven waraxe, etc.) in two hands. As a personal fan of that style of swordsmanship I present these feats.
New Feats
Hand-and-a-Half Specialist [Fighter/General]
You have mastered the art of using your hand-and-a-half weapon (HaaHW) in two hands as well as one.
Prerequisites:Str 13, Dex 13, Exotic Weapon Proficiency: (any hand-and-a-half weapon)
Benefits: When wielding an HaaHW with both hands. As a full attack action you gain an extra attack at your full attack bonus but incure a -2 on all attacks during that round.
Normal: A HaaHW held with two hands is treated like a normal two-handed weapon.
Special: This only applies to HaaHWs for which you have Exotic Weapon Proficiency. The extra attack only gains half of the normal (Strength and a half) bonus to damage. This does stack with haste effects.
Hand-and-a-Half Defense [Fighter/General]
Your have increased skill at parrying with a HaaHW weilded in two hands.
Prerequisites: Dex 13, Exotic Weapon Proficiency: (any HaaHW)
Benefits: When weilding a HaaHW in two hands you gain a +1 skill bonus to AC.
Normal: A HaaHW grants no bonus to AC.
Special: This bonus is Dex based and is thus lost whenever Dex bonus to AC would be.
Hand-and-a-Half Expert[Fighter]
Your skill and speed with a HaaHW is uncanny.
Prerequisites: Str 13, Dex 15, Exotic Weapon Proficiency: (any HaaHW), Hand-and-a-Half Specialist, fighter lvl 6
Benefits: You gain a second extra attack when using Hand-and-a-Half Specialist. This attack is at your second highest BAB. You still take -2 to all attacks that round.
Normal: You only gain one extra attack from Hand-and-a-Half Specialist.
Special: This only applies to HaaHWs for which you have Exotic Weapon Proficiency. The extra attacks only gains half of the normal (Strength and a half) bonus to damage. This does stack with haste effects.
Hand-and-a-Half Master [Fighter]
Your mastery of HaaHW has reached incredible levels.
Prerequisites: Str 15, Dex 15, Exotic Weapon Proficiency: (any HaaHW), Hand-and-a-Half Specialist, Hand-and-a-Half Expert, Weapon Focus (any hand-and-a-half weapon), fighter lvl 10
Benefits: You no longer take a -2 to attacks while using Hand-and-a-Half Specialist/Expert. You gain Exotic Weapon Proficiency in all HaaHW for which you have proficiency when used in two hands.
Normal: You take a -2 to all attacks when using HaaHW Specialist/Expert. Each Exotic Weapon Proficiency must be taken individually.
Special: The extra attack only gains half of the normal (Strength and a half) bonus to damage. This does stack with haste effects.
Improved Hand-and-a-Half Defense [Fighter/General]
Your have amazing skill at parrying with a HaaHW weilded in two hands.
Prerequisites: Dex 15, Exotic Weapon Proficiency: (any HaaHW), Hand-and-a-Half Defense, Weapon Focus: (any HaaHW)
Benefits: When weilding a HaaHW in two hands you gain an additional +1 skill bonus to AC. This stacks with Hand-and-a-Half Defense giving you a total of +2 to AC.
Normal: A HaaHW grants no bonus to AC.
Special: This bonus is Dex based and is thus lost whenever Dex bonus to AC would be.
Katana Finesse [Fighter/General]
Your style of fighting with a bastard-sword in two hands is based on speed not on strength.
Prerequisites: Dex 13, Exotic Weapon Proficiency: bastard-sword, Weapon Finesse, Weapon Focus: bastard-sword
Benefits: Weapon Finesse can be applied to a bastard-sword when used in two hands.
Normal: Weapon Finesse cannot be applied to a bastard-sword.
Alternate Weapon
Katana (Alt.)
A specialized bastard-sword favored by samurai, this weapon is curved to increase its sharpness. (A Hand-and-a-Half Scimitar, in effect.) They are never less than masterwork quality.
Classification: One-Handed Exotic, Two-Handed Martial
Damage: 1d8
Critical: 18-20/x2
Price: 400 gp (masterwork always)
